Burundi's e-commerce sector is experiencing steady growth, with a 2.8% conversion rate reflecting increasing consumer trust and platform improvements. Mobile commerce dominates the landscape, accounting for 65% of transactions, driven by widespread mobile phone usage and expanding internet access. Despite a relatively low digital payment penetration of 18%, the trend indicates a gradual shift towards digital financial services, boosting online retail opportunities.
The total e-commerce revenue is projected to reach USD 45 million in 2026, supported by the rise in online shoppers, estimated at 520,000. As infrastructure and digital literacy improve, Burundi's e-commerce market is poised for significant expansion. Small and medium-sized enterprises are increasingly adopting online platforms, which will likely enhance conversion rates and diversify the digital retail ecosystem further.

What are the main factors driving e-commerce growth in Burundi?
Increasing mobile device usage, expanding internet access, and improving digital payment options are key drivers of Burundi's e-commerce growth in 2026.
How can businesses improve their online conversion rates in Burundi?
Businesses can enhance user experience, offer local payment solutions, and invest in digital marketing to boost conversion rates in Burundi's evolving e-commerce market.
